Problem: I'm trying to create a conditional that tests whether or not a Term WYSIWYG field has content.

Solution: There is a known issue with special characters in conditional content, which can break conditionals. As a workaround, convert double-quotes to

& quot;

without the space, and convert single-quotes to

'

Our developers are working on a permanent solution to the problem.
